Mido Multi Star TV Case 70'S Vintage Automatic Men's Watch Swiss ETA 2879 - MIDO introduced their first TV watch in 1973. Patek did not release the Nautilus until 1976, good review but this shoud be corrected, in any case the Nautilus has many similarities to Mido TV Case same as the Glashutte Original of Soviet era East Germany, Mido TV case is the Original look at the Mido Multi Star. last but not least: In 1979 Piaget introduced the Polo, after the 1976 Nautilus and 6 Years after Mido Multistar TV case.
